Do we need tickets or prior booking for the Wagah Border Ceremony on 15th August?

Entry to the Wagah Border Beating Retreat Ceremony is free, and no regular ticket is required. However, on 15th August, the ceremony attracts thousands of visitors, making it one of the busiest days of the year. Seating is available on a first come, first served basis, so it is recommended to arrive between 2:00 PM and 3:00 PM to get a good seat.

If available, you can also apply for a VIP or Special Entry Pass through the official BSF portal before your visit. Since availability is limited, it is best to book well in advance.
